The Taiwan Department of Health (DOH) on 21 Jul 2011 reported its 1st
imported case of tularemia since 2007.

The patient, a 67 year old United States citizen from San Francisco,
California, showed symptoms of fever before flying to Taiwan on 26 Jun
2011. The man was confirmed to have the disease on Mon 18 Jul 2011,
after being admitted to a Taipei hospital for fever, pneumonia, and a
build-up of fluid in his lungs, Centers for Disease Control (CDC)
deputy director Shih Wen-yi said in a press release. However, he was
expected to be released from the hospital soon.

Tularemia is a zoonotic disease, meaning it is transmitted from
animals to humans and cannot be transmitted from human to human. The
disease is caused by the bacterium _Francisella tularensis_, which is
found in various types of fowl, fish, rodents, and mammals, which can
be spread through bites, inhalation, or direct contact.

[Although not apparently related to bioterrorism in this case,
tularemia is a category A bioterrorism agent and the pneumonic form is
likely to be the one associated with intentional spread. The
circumstances of exposure in this case are not stated
.

Tularemia is caused by _F. tularensis_, a small, non-motile, Gram
negative intracellular coccobacillus. It can be found in a variety of
animal hosts, notably lagomorphs (rabbits and hares), aquatic rodents
(muskrats, beavers, and water voles), other rodents (water and wood
rats and mice), squirrels, and cats. In the United States an outbreak
involving commercially distributed prairie dogs occurred in 2002.

_F. tularensis_ can be recovered from contaminated water, soil, and
vegetation as it can persist for weeks under ideal environmental
conditions. _F. tularensis_ also can be found in amoebas (such as,
_Acanthamoeba_), which can become airborne in some settings, and may
represent a significant environmental reservoir for this bacterium.

Humans can become incidentally infected through diverse environmental
exposures: bites by infected ticks and deerflies; contact with
infectious animal tissues or fluids; direct contact with or ingestion
of contaminated food, water, or soil; and inhalation of infective
aerosols. In one case, bacteria were aerosolized from the fur of a dog
as it shook itself off after entering a home. Finally, there are
several reports of tularemia in humans following bites from infected
domestic cats. It is highly infectious, with as few as 10 organisms
needed to cause disease. Humans can develop severe and sometimes fatal
illness, but do not transmit the disease to others. The typical
incubation period is 3 to 5 days, with a range of one to 14 days.

The clinical presentation of tularemia depends on the route of
exposure. Airborne _F. tularensis_ would mainly cause
pleuropneumonitis. Exposures that penetrate broken skin result in
ulceroglandular or glandular disease. The onset of tularemia is
usually abrupt, with fever, headache, chills and rigors, generalized
body aches (often prominent in the low back), coryza, and sore throat.
Nausea, vomiting, and diarrhea may occur. Sweats, fever, chills,
progressive weakness, malaise, anorexia, and weight loss characterize
the continuing illness. - Mod.LL]
